The Tánaiste Simon Coveney has said it is possible to form a government quickly and he said Fianna Fail and Fine Gael are working towards that.

Speaking in the Seanad, as it debates emergency Covid-19 legislation, he called on others to play their part in forming a Government saying "your country needs you." Mr Coveney said his priority now was finding a way to work with others to find a Government that can command a lasting majority.

He said Ireland needs a Government that is strong, stable, diverse and one that can pass legislation at short notice. The Tánaiste said the emergency Covid-19 legislation would be the most important ever passed in the house.
